Central won the last time they faced Norrix and things went their way on Monday too. The Central Bearcats took down the Norrix Knights 63-46. Given the Bearcats' advantage in MaxPreps' Michigan basketball rankings (they are ranked 157th, while the Knights are ranked 518th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Central has been performing well recently as they've won nine of their last 11 matchups. That's provided a nice bump to their 12-5 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 52.2 points over those games. Norrix is on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 3-17.
Looking ahead, Central will square off against Sturgis at 7: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Norrix does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
